RTP means return to player. It is the long-run percentage a slot is designed to pay back across many spins. A 96% RTP means the game is built to return 96 units on average for every 100 wagered over a very large sample, not on a single session. For beginners, that is like the average fuel economy of a car: it describes the model, not one trip. Tonybet’s Christmas slots selection should be read through that lens because a festive theme does not change the underlying math.
Bonus terms are the rules attached to a promotion. Wagering requirements are the number of times a bonus amount must be played through before withdrawal. Game weighting is the percentage of a bet that counts toward those requirements. A slot may contribute 100%, while other games may contribute less. - Identity verification: a standard check to confirm the account holder.
- Method matching: a rule that may require withdrawals to return through the same route used for deposit.
- Processing time: the period Tonybet needs before funds leave pending status.
- Pending withdrawal: money approved by the player but not yet sent.
For a beginner, the same-method idea is easy to picture. If money entered through one door, the cashier may send it back through that same door. That is common in regulated gambling and helps reduce fraud risk. It can also affect speed, because some methods settle faster than others.
